About Aalyria:

Aalyria is a leading technology company that supplies laser communications technology and temporospatial software-defined networking software platforms to the aerospace & defense industry. Aalyria spun out of Google a year ago and is at the forefront of innovation in the field of satellite and airborne mesh networks, as well as cislunar and deep space communications. Aalyria's flagship product, Spacetime, is a cutting-edge software-defined networking platform that orchestrates radio resource management, schedule of pointing and handovers, and networking functions for aerospace & defense communication networks.

Role Overview:

As an Integration Specialist for Spacetime Customer Onboarding, you will be responsible for supporting customers in the successful evaluation and initialization of Spacetime. You will work closely with customers to gather the necessary information and translate it into the appropriate fields within Spacetime's APIs, which are based on gRPC and protocol buffers. Additionally, you may perform the necessary configuration work within Spacetime to initialize the customer's instance. Your role will play a vital part in ensuring a seamless onboarding experience for customers and facilitating the integration of their specific requirements into Spacetime.

Key Responsibilities:

Collaborate with customers to understand their specific requirements and desired outcomes

Gather information such as the motion of mobile terminals, ephemerides of satellites, antenna radiation patterns, RF channels and bandwidths, C/N+I thresholds, ground segment network topology, Layer 2 and Layer 3 protocols, ground station coordinates, SLAs, and more

Translate customer-provided information into the appropriate fields within Spacetime's open APIs (based on gRPC and protocol buffers) writing code to automate the steps in any of Golang, Java, C++, or Python.

Perform the necessary configuration work within Spacetime to initialize the customer's instance, if required

Work closely with the engineering and customer success teams to address any technical challenges or requirements during the onboarding process

Provide technical support and guidance to customers during the evaluation phase, ensuring a smooth transition into using Spacetime

Document and communicate customer-specific configurations and requirements to internal teams
